< prev index next >

test/jdk/java/beans/XMLDecoder/8028054/Task.java

Print this page

        

*** 1,7 **** /* ! * Copyright (c) 2013, 2015, Oracle and/or its affiliates. All rights reserved. * DO NOT ALTER OR REMOVE COPYRIGHT NOTICES OR THIS FILE HEADER. * * This code is free software; you can redistribute it and/or modify it * under the terms of the GNU General Public License version 2 only, as * published by the Free Software Foundation. --- 1,7 ---- /* ! * Copyright (c) 2013, 2018, Oracle and/or its affiliates. All rights reserved. * DO NOT ALTER OR REMOVE COPYRIGHT NOTICES OR THIS FILE HEADER. * * This code is free software; you can redistribute it and/or modify it * under the terms of the GNU General Public License version 2 only, as * published by the Free Software Foundation.
*** 96,115 **** Predicate<String> startsWithJavaDataTransfer = path -> path.toString().startsWith("java.datatransfer/java"); Predicate<String> startsWithJavaRMI = path -> path.toString().startsWith("java.rmi/java"); Predicate<String> startsWithJavaSmartCardIO = path -> path.toString().startsWith("java.smartcardio/java"); Predicate<String> startsWithJavaManagement = path -> path.toString().startsWith("java.management/java"); Predicate<String> startsWithJavaXML = path -> path.toString().startsWith("java.xml/java"); - Predicate<String> startsWithJavaXMLBind = path -> path.toString().startsWith("java.xml.bind/java"); Predicate<String> startsWithJavaScripting = path -> path.toString().startsWith("java.scripting/java"); Predicate<String> startsWithJavaNaming = path -> path.toString().startsWith("java.naming/java"); Predicate<String> startsWithJavaSQL = path -> path.toString().startsWith("java.sql/java"); - Predicate<String> startsWithJavaActivation = path -> path.toString().startsWith("java.activation/java"); Predicate<String> startsWithJavaCompiler = path -> path.toString().startsWith("java.compiler/java"); - Predicate<String> startsWithJavaAnnotations = path -> path.toString().startsWith("java.annotations/java"); - Predicate<String> startsWithJavaTransaction = path -> path.toString().startsWith("java.transaction/java"); Predicate<String> startsWithJavaLogging = path -> path.toString().startsWith("java.logging/java"); - Predicate<String> startsWithJavaCorba = path -> path.toString().startsWith("java.corba/java"); Predicate<String> startsWithJavaPrefs = path -> path.toString().startsWith("java.prefs/java"); fileNames = Files.walk(modules) .map(Path::toString) .filter(path -> path.toString().contains("java")) --- 96,110 ----
*** 119,138 **** .or(startsWithJavaDataTransfer) .or(startsWithJavaRMI) .or(startsWithJavaSmartCardIO) .or(startsWithJavaManagement) .or(startsWithJavaXML) - .or(startsWithJavaXMLBind) .or(startsWithJavaScripting) .or(startsWithJavaNaming) .or(startsWithJavaSQL) - .or(startsWithJavaActivation) .or(startsWithJavaCompiler) - .or(startsWithJavaAnnotations) - .or(startsWithJavaTransaction) .or(startsWithJavaLogging) - .or(startsWithJavaCorba) .or(startsWithJavaPrefs)) .map(s -> s.replace('/', '.')) .filter(path -> path.toString().endsWith(".class")) .map(s -> s.substring(0, s.length() - 6)) // drop .class .map(s -> s.substring(s.indexOf("."))) --- 114,128 ----
< prev index next >